Silver prices went up by a whopping Rs 603 to Rs 48,725 per kg in futures trading today as participants widened their positions, tracking a firm trend in global market.
At the Multi Commodity Exchange, silver for delivery in far-month December was trading notably higher by Rs 603, or 1.25 per cent, to Rs 48,725 per kg, in a business turnover of 47 lots.
Similarly, the white metal for delivery in September was up by Rs 595, or 1.27 per cent, to Rs 47,614 per kg in 1,608 lots.

Analysts said a firming trend overseas where silver rallied after the US Federal Reserve indicated it would take a slow, measured approach to any interest rate hikes amid a weakening dollar raised demand for the safe-haven, mainly influenced the white metal prices at futures trade.
Globally, silver rose 3.75 per cent to USD 20.32 an ounce in New York yesterday.
